The days are long gone when you could stroll into any hardware store to get duplicate keys for your car. Today, most vehicles require special electronic keys that need to be programmed by a dealer or a professional locksmith.
This process can take a few minutes and is safe if it is done correctly. Check the owner's manual for specific instructions.

The car key fob contains an embedded chip that transmits the signal to your vehicle. If the codes match, it will unlock your door and start your engine. This will stop hackers from stealing the code and gaining access to your vehicle. This makes them a useful security measure. They can be expensive to replace if damaged or worn out over time. It is essential to keep an extra key fob in case that one is damaged or lost.
There are a variety of reasons why you may need to reprogram your key fob. It could be because it's worn down or isn't working properly or been submerged in water and lost its functionality. In certain situations, your key fob may not be able to send the correct signals to the car and it won't start.
In addition to the key itself, there are a number of other parts that make your car key function properly. The most commonly used is the transponder chip, which is a tiny radio-frequency identification device that is placed on top of your key and transmits signals to your vehicle. It is an essential component of the security system that is in your car, and must be properly programmed for it to function.
You can usually get your key fob programed by a locksmith in your area. Some cars, like Mercedes, use proprietary technologies which only permit dealerships to create keys. This is a good thing however it limits your options.
It is possible to change the programming of your key, but it is a difficult task. The majority of car key fobs can be programmed with a little patience and perseverance. You can save money by doing it yourself if are willing to put in the effort.
It's worth noting that you should only try this only if you have a functioning key. A spare key is always an excellent idea. Modern automobiles are equipped with advanced security features to guard against theft and impersonation. This includes a microchip integrated in the key that relays information to the vehicle's computer and disables the kill switch. These chips are not compatible with key cutters that are sold on the high street. However, some key programming techniques could corrupt the data stored on the chip. This is why it's best to let a professional handle the job.
